Tokyo 42, released in 2017, is an action-adventure indie game set in a vibrant, futuristic Tokyo. Players take on the role of an assassin entangled in a deep conspiracy that threatens everyone in this stylized open-world environment. Notable for its unique isometric viewpoint and engaging gameplay, Tokyo 42 offers a blend of exploration, stealth, and fast-paced action, all wrapped in a visually striking design.
